About the role

Accountabilities:

    • Lead end-to-end Cloudability implementation, optimization, and FinOps consulting engagements, including discovery, solution design, configuration, deployment, troubleshooting, and ongoing advisory.
    • Conduct customer workshops to assess cloud environments, business requirements, FinOps maturity, governance needs, and financial management objectives.
    • Design and configure Cloudability solutions, including billing integrations, business mappings, tagging, cost allocation, reporting, dashboards, and executive insights.
    • Advise customers on cloud governance, budgeting, forecasting, chargeback/showback, commitment management, and FinOps operating models.
    • Drive cloud cost optimization initiatives such as rightsizing, reservations, savings plans, waste reduction, and commitment optimization across multi-cloud environments.
    • Lead integrations between Cloudability, Apptio One, and enterprise platforms such as CMDB, ERP, ITSM, BI tools, and other business systems.
    • Support Apptio One initiatives covering Cost Transparency, budgeting, planning, service costing, financial reporting, and Technology Business Management.
    • Design and maintain Cloudability–Apptio One data flows, business mappings, financial models, and reporting structures to ensure consistent and accurate information.
    • Develop cloud cost models, executive dashboards, financial reports, and actionable recommendations for business and technology leadership.
    • Provide technical leadership and mentor consultants on Cloudability configurations, FinOps practices, implementation approaches, and reusable delivery assets.
    • Serve as a trusted customer advisor, presenting project updates, optimization opportunities, financial insights, and strategic recommendations to senior stakeholders.
    • Support pre-sales activities, including solution demonstrations, RFP responses, solution architecture, scoping, and effort estimation.
    • Contribute to the continuous improvement of FinOps methodologies, delivery accelerators, implementation frameworks, and practice assets.
    • Stay current with FinOps Foundation standards, cloud pricing models, Cloudability capabilities, and evolving cloud financial management practices.
    • Requirements:

      •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Finance, Engineering, or a related discipline.
      • 6–10+ years of experience in IT consulting, cloud, technology financial management, or a related field, including at least 3 years of hands-on Cloudability implementation and administration experience.
      • Strong understanding of FinOps principles, Cloud Financial Management, cloud billing, cost allocation, governance, and optimization.
      • Experience working with AWS, Azure, and/or Google Cloud billing and cost-management capabilities.
      • Experience with IBM Apptio One implementation or administration is highly preferred, along with practical knowledge of Technology Business Management (TBM).
      • Demonstrated experience leading customer workshops, consulting engagements, implementation projects, and executive-level presentations.
      •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ities, with the ability to interpret complex billing and financial datasets and translate them into actionable recommendations.
      • Hands-on knowledge of Cloudability features such as business mapping, cost sharing, cost allocation, reporting, dashboards, and financial modeling.
      • Familiarity with TBM Taxonomy, cost model design, Cloudability–Apptio One integration, cloud budgeting and forecasting, and multi-cloud financial reporting.
      • Experience with AWS Cost & Usage Reports (CUR), Azure Cost Management, SQL, advanced Excel, Power BI or Tableau, REST APIs, and cloud billing data analysis is valuable.
      • Exposure to Kubernetes and container cost management, cloud governance frameworks, FinOps maturity assessments, executive reporting, and cloud optimization programs is an advantage.
      • Relevant certifications such as FinOps Certified Practitioner or Professional, AWS, Azure, Google Cloud, IBM Apptio Cloudability, or IBM Apptio One certifications are preferred.
      • Excellent communication, presentation, stakeholder-management, and customer-facing consulting sk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across technical and financial teams.
